Abstract:
Domestic energy characteristic determines that the coal-fired power will remain the main power supply in China for a long time. The development of 700℃ ultra-supercritical units is one of the future development directions of coal-fired power generation technology with high efficiency and low-carbon emission.Moreover, the improvement of coal-fired unit parameters cannot be achieved without material innovation. In this paper, the potential materials of main pipelines of 700℃ ultra-supercritical unit are analyzed, GH 984G, Nimonic 263, Haynes 282 and Inconel 740H are proposed as the candidate materials for the main steam pipe and the high-temperature reheat steam pipe. At the same time, in order to reduce the construction cost of the unit and improve the comprehensive economy of the unit, the layout of the main plant, main steam and high temperature reheat steam pipe specifications are optimized, and suggestions on four pipe specifications and the layout of the main plant are put forward.
